Output 577883c0e8670aa8655a68252a1f3b4f229c86045b6a26f4e3ba75c33beb200c:4

value
2453964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ac7ab328fa60c2d029fa0174c3bfe78998b68f35 OP_EQUAL
address
MPd9Sm1gyF3yNHUXmRpd4x5QEqG4VA1xkA
transaction
577883c0e8670aa8655a68252a1f3b4f229c86045b6a26f4e3ba75c33beb200c
spent
true